


The person detained on suspicion of the murder of Ivan Novikov, serviceman of the 102nd Russian military base in Gyumri, has made confessionary statements, ArmInfo's sources report.
Earlier Alexey Polyukhovich, the deputy head of the base, reported that a contract serviceman had been detained over the case.
To recall, the dead body of Ivan Novikov, a Russian serviceman of the 102nd military base in Gyumri, was found near the Mother Armenia monument in Gyumri. The Investigative Committee of Armenia has confirmed this information. According to the Committee, traces of violence - stab and slash wounds - were found on Novikov's body. A criminal case has been instituted under Article 104 of the Armenian Criminal Code (murder). Investigation is underway and all measures are being taken to find out the circumstances of the incident.
Law-enforces and forensic experts are currently working at the scene. Novikov is known to have served at the 102nd base for 3 months. It is rumored that the murder was preceded by a quarrel involving three persons.
